Appointment of Chief Executive Officer
Further to the announcement made on 24 November 2017,
IndigoVision is pleased to announce that Pedro Simoes has been
confirmed as Chief Executive Officer of the Company and has joined
the Board as an executive director with immediate effect.
Pedro, who was initially appointed as the Company's Senior Vice
President - Global Sales in October 2017 and took over as Interim
Chief Executive Officer in November, is an experienced global sales
leader in the security industry, with over 13 years experience in
the sector, and prior to joining the Group he spent nearly six
years with Avigilon Corporation (TSX: AVO) where he was ultimately
responsible for leading its Global salesforce and driving revenue
worldwide.
George Elliot, Chairman, commented:
"I am delighted to be able to announce Pedro's appointment as
Chief Executive Officer of IndigoVision. We believe he is the right
leader to drive the Group's sales and increase profitability by
focussing on innovative security solutions for our customers."
Pedro Vasco Tadeu Felix Simoes (aged 41) is interested in 15,000
shares in IndigoVision, representing 0.2 per cent. of the current
issued share capital of the Company. There is no further
information to be disclosed pursuant to Rule 17 and Schedule Two
paragraph (g) of the AIM Rules for Companies.

About Indigovision
IndigoVision is a leader in the design and supply of high
performance, highly-intelligent video security systems for security
installations of differing sizes and complexity. From video capture
and transmission to analysis and storage, IndigoVision's networked
video security systems provide the best quality and most secure
video evidence, using market leading compression technology to
minimise bandwidth and reduce storage costs.
IndigoVision's technology is ideally suited for use in mission
critical facilities such as government, oil and gas, transport,
cities, industry, education, police, prisons and casinos to improve
public safety, protect assets, develop organisations' operational
efficiency and support law enforcement.
IndigoVision has sales and support teams in 23 countries and
operates through 18 regional centres, in Edinburgh, London, Paris,
Amsterdam, Dusseldorf, Johannesburg, Dubai, Mumbai, Singapore,
Macau, Shanghai, Sydney, Mexico City, Toronto, Bogotá, New Jersey,
Buenos Aires and Sao Paulo.
IndigoVision partners with a network of some 1,000 trained and
authorised IndigoVision resellers to provide local system design,
installation and servicing to IndigoVision's system users.
